On average, a Chevy Cruze lasts between 200.000 – 220.000 miles. A Cruze needs to go to the garage for unscheduled repairs about 0.41 times per year, with a 12% chance of the problem being severe. Furthermore, Chevy Cruze owners spend an average of $545 per year on repair costs.

Chevy Cruze is a long-lasting vehicle and can give you a solid 200,000 to 250,000 miles before requiring significant repairs. That hugely depends on how you take care of your Cruze. With that number, and knowing the average 15,000 miles a year, you can expect 13 to 17 years of driving from a Chevy Cruze.
